我有一个警报应用程序,可播放.mp3警报并使用一个.wav发出本地通知。
作为更新,我只是花费了大量的代码来设置和升级系统,以将分配的MP3转换为Wav,因此用户即使在本地通知中也可以听到任何选定的警报。
既然我完成了所有事情,原来我需要从主 bundle 包中提取本地notif .wavs,但是您无法写入主 bundle 包。
开 Jest 在我身上。
根据我的发现,这是一个失败的原因,但也许有些可以解决。还是阴 ionic 物质值得与苹果接触?
附言升级系统是一项不错的工作,对背景进行了多种处理,可用于将来的升级,需要8秒才能在iPhone 4上转换24 mp3。
最佳答案
您不能在UILocalNotifications中播放应用程序生成的音频(异常(exception):越狱的设备),因为您已经声明过,不允许写入主 bundle 包。在开始项目之前,您应该已经知道这一点。
关于iphone - 将生成的音频发送到UILocalNotification,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7643667/